🏗️ Project Scope

LearnWPData will let users create, view, and manage notes stored in a custom DB table.

Core features:

  1. Custom DB tables

    • wp_lwpd_notes → stores notes (id, user_id, title, content, status, created_at, updated_at)
    • (Optional) wp_lwpd_notes_meta → future extensibility
    • (Optional) wp_lwpd_notes_categories → simple relations
  2. CRUD Layer

    • A dedicated NotesRepository class to handle all DB operations
    • Future-proof: designed to be reusable for other plugins
  3. REST API

    • /wp-json/learnwpdata/v1/notes
    • GET, POST, DELETE basic endpoints
  4. Gutenberg Block

    • Dynamic block showing the current user’s notes
    • Uses REST API under the hood

🧱 Mini Framework Approach

This plugin is Phase 1 of a reusable DB & Data Manipulation framework.
It will establish:

  • Base classes for creating and managing custom tables
    • BaseTable → handles table creation, schema versioning, and upgrades
    • BaseRepository → generic CRUD operations
  • Interfaces/Traits for reusable patterns
  • Consistent naming conventions for future tables

Future plugins will reuse these base classes for faster development.


📂 Folder Structure

learn-wp-data/ │ ├── includes/ # PHP backend (PSR-4 autoload) │ ├── Framework/ # Base classes (Table, Repository) │ ├── Notes/ # Plugin-specific Notes logic │ └── Plugin.php # Main bootstrap │ ├── src/ # JS (Gutenberg blocks, REST integration) │ ├── blocks/ │ └── api/ │ ├── build/ # Compiled JS (using @wordpress/scripts) │ ├── learn-wp-data.php # Main plugin file └── README.md # This file


🛠️ Tech & Standards

  • PHP 7.4+ with PSR-4 autoloading (Composer)
  • @wordpress/scripts for JS bundling
  • OOP & design principles
    • Single Responsibility Principle for classes
    • Clear separation of DB logic vs business logic vs presentation
  • YAGNI-friendly → keep it simple, scalable later

💡 Quick Start

  1. Clone the repo
  2. composer dump-autoload for PSR-4
  3. npm install && npm start for JS
  4. Activate the plugin → tables auto-create on activation
